Meta delivered a quarter that defied conventional market expectations, presenting revenue figures that comfortably surpassed Wall Street estimates while its core advertising operations demonstrated sustained momentum. Yet the financial narrative shifted dramatically during the subsequent earnings call. The company announced a substantial upward revision to its capital expenditure forecast, projecting annual infrastructure spending between one hundred twenty-five billion and one hundred forty-five billion dollars. This adjustment represents a ten billion dollar increase across the entire range compared to the guidance provided earlier in the year. The revelation immediately triggered a pronounced market correction, demonstrating how quickly investor confidence can pivot when infrastructure commitments accelerate beyond initial projections.

The Financial Shift Behind the Guidance Revision

Capital expenditure guidance serves as a critical barometer for corporate ambition and operational planning. When technology firms adjust these projections mid-year, it signals a fundamental recalibration of their strategic priorities. The company cited higher component pricing and additional data center costs as the primary drivers for this revision. The organization is actively constructing the physical foundation required to support future capacity demands. This expansion requires specialized hardware, advanced cooling systems, and extensive power infrastructure. The financial implications are substantial, as these costs accumulate rapidly across multiple global facilities. Management has committed to accelerating this buildout to maintain competitive positioning in the rapidly evolving technology landscape.

The decision to raise the forecast by ten billion dollars on both ends reflects a calculated risk. Corporate leadership views artificial intelligence infrastructure as the defining investment of the current economic era. They believe that hesitation could result in a permanent competitive disadvantage. To finance this ambitious expansion, the organization is preparing to issue twenty-five billion dollars in bonds. This debt instrument will provide immediate liquidity while spreading the financial burden across future fiscal periods. The bond market will closely evaluate the creditworthiness and cash flow stability. Investors will scrutinize how this debt load interacts with existing operational expenses and long-term profitability targets.

How Does Meta Compare to Its Tech Peers?

The broader technology sector is currently experiencing a synchronized infrastructure expansion. Alphabet recently adjusted its own capital expenditure guidance to a range of one hundred eighty billion to one hundred ninety billion dollars. Microsoft continues to direct substantial resources toward Azure artificial intelligence capacity. This collective behavior indicates a shared industry conviction about the future of computing. Hyperscalers are operating under the assumption that infrastructure dominance will dictate economic leadership for the coming decade. Each company is attempting to secure a foundational position before competitors can establish similar advantages. The scale of these commitments reflects a fundamental shift in how technology value is created and captured.

The organization faces a distinct challenge regarding the visibility of its return on investment. Google Cloud demonstrated sixty-three percent growth during the recent quarter, providing a clear feedback loop between artificial intelligence investment and revenue generation. Artificial intelligence initiatives are more diffuse across its ecosystem. Some improvements operate quietly within the advertising engine, enhancing targeting precision and campaign efficiency. Other initiatives target personal artificial intelligence agents and companion applications that remain years away from commercial viability. This lack of immediate monetization visibility makes the financial commitment appear riskier to analysts. The company must eventually demonstrate how these disparate projects will converge into profitable business units.

The Historical Context of Tech Investment Cycles

Technology companies have repeatedly demonstrated the ability to recover from aggressive spending periods. The organization experienced a severe market valuation decline during twenty twenty-two due to metaverse investment concerns. The stock price reflected investor skepticism regarding the timeline and profitability of those virtual reality initiatives. However, the company executed a strategic pivot during twenty twenty-three and twenty twenty-four. The subsequent efficiency drive restored market confidence and triggered a dramatic valuation recovery. This historical precedent suggests that management possesses the operational discipline to adjust course when necessary. The underlying advertising cash flow provides a substantial buffer against prolonged investment cycles.
